The Meg 2 to be directed by Ben Wheatley

Headlined by Jason Statham, The Meg was a shark thriller adapted from a novel by Steve Alten

Filmmaker Ben Wheatley will direct the sequel of the 2018 shark thriller, The Meg. The director's Rebecca, starring Armie Hammer, Lily James, and Kristin Scott Thomas, was released recently on Netflix. He is also famous for helming films like Sightseers, Kill ListHigh Rise, and Free Fire.

The announcement of The Meg 2 comes two years after the first film became a hit. The original was lead by Jason Statham and he is expected to reprise his role in the sequel. Directed by Jon Turteltaub, The Meg had Statham playing a shark expert fighting a giant megalodon that surfaces from the Mariana Trench, the deepest part of the world's oceans located in the Pacific.

The film was adapted from a novel by Steve Alten and it also featured Li Bingbing, Rainn Wilson, and Ruby Rose in pivotal roles.

An official announcement about the rest of the cast and crew of The Meg 2 is expected from the makers soon.
